How do I automatically follow up with cattle buyers after a quote?
Every Monday, WebRun reviews your buyer contact log in Google Sheets and finds quotes from the past 7 days with no response or commitment. It checks current prices in Performance Livestock Analytics for context and drafts a follow-up email in Gmail for each open buyer. A Slack summary tells you which drafts are waiting for your review before any message is sent.

Will it send follow-up emails to buyers without my approval?
No. Every follow-up email is drafted in Gmail and left unsent. Nothing reaches a buyer until you review each draft and send it yourself.
How does it know which buyers still need a follow-up?
It reads your buyer contact log in Google Sheets. Buyers who have a response or commitment date logged are skipped automatically. Only open, uncommitted quotes trigger a draft.
Can I customize the tone or content of the follow-up drafts?
Yes. At setup you provide WebRun with example follow-up language or a preferred tone. It uses that as its template for every draft so messages stay consistent with your voice.
